This basic recipe can be used for an endless amount of cookies, all you need is a quick peek into the pantry and use what you already have on hand. Just swap the cake mix for any other kind and the use a different "mixin" and you have another type of cookie! One of my other favorites is Funfetti cake mix with extra sprinkles!
Ingredients:
1 box cake mix (just the dry ingredients from 15.25-18.25 oz box)
1/2 cup vegetable oil
2 eggs
1/2 cup mix-ins of your choosing
Directions:
Preheat the oven to 350 degrees. Prepare your baking sheet by adding parchment paper or a silicone mat.
In a bowl, mix together the cake mix, vegetable oil and eggs until combined.
Stir in your mix-in(s) of preference.
Using a cookie scoop, drop the dough onto the baking sheet, about 2 inches apart.
Bake 10-12 minutes and remove from oven. Cool for 2 minutes on the baking sheet then transfer to a cooling rack or a sheet of waxed paper.
Here are over 20 other options if you are feeling motivated:
Strawberry & white chocolate chips
Strawberry & coconut
Strawberry & valentine's M&Ms
Strawberry & chocolate chips & coconut (think about those Neapolitan candies)
Butter Pecan & butterscotch chips
Butter Pecan & pecans - of course!
Chocolate & Andes mints
Chocolate & chopped peanut butter cups
Chocolate & white chocolate chip
Chocolate & chopped peppermint candy canes
Red Velvet & white chocolate chip
Spice cake & chopped pecans
Carrot cake & coconut
Carrot cake & chopped walnuts
German chocolate & coconut
Cherry Chip & dark chocolate chips
Cherry Chip & dried cherries (add on some white chocolate drizzle for a flavor similar to my Cherry Cordial Bark)
Lemon & white chocolate chips & poppy seeds
Funfetti & rainbow sprinkles
Funfetti & M&Ms
Butter & chopped toffee
Yellow & chocolate chunks
